# Loop Budget Guard Run at the **start** and **end** of every loop iteration. ## Start of run 1. Read `loop-budget.md` for daily caps and kill-switch flags. 2. Read recent entries in `loop-run-log.md` (last 24h). 3. Sum `tokens_estimate` for the active pattern today. 4. If spend ≥ 80% of the pattern's daily cap → **report-only mode** (no sub-agents, no auto-fix). 5. If spend ≥ 100% or `loop-pause-all` is set → **exit immediately** with a one-line note in STATE.md. 6. If watchlist/state has no actionable items → **exit in <5k tokens** (do not spawn sub-agents). ## End of run Append one JSON object to `loop-run-log.md`: ```json { "run_id": "<ISO8601>", "pattern": "<pattern-id>", "duration_s": <number>, "items_found": <number>, "actions_taken": <number>, "escalations": <number>, "tokens_estimate": <number>, "outcome": "no-op | report-only | fix-proposed | escalated" } ``` ## Rules - Never exceed `max sub-agent spawns/run` from `loop-budget.md`. - High-cadence patterns (CI Sweeper, PR Babysitter) **must** early-exit when nothing is actionable. - On self-throttle, append a line to `loop-budget.md` under **Alerts This Period**.
